Hassler Roma is a legendary luxury five star hotel in Rome City Center located at the top of the Spanish Steps. It is the residence of choice for a memorable experience in the Eternal City.

Arguably the queen of Rome’s hospitality trade, the Hotel Hassler is regally ensconced atop the Spanish Steps in the city’s historic center and on that attribute alone scores premium points for visiting acccessibility to Rome’s famed tourist sites like St. Peter’s, the Pantheon, the Coliseum and the Fontana di Trevi. A property of the Leading Hotels of the World hotelier group, the intimate Hassler has 87 rooms and suites accommodating a range of stay requirements from the lavishly sumptuous for visiting royalty to the merely posh for the lower orders. All visitor ranks nonetheless receive the discreetly attentive service featuring the hotel’s signature outstanding guest care. Rome has an overwhelming panoply of attractions that easily draws guests’ attention away from appreciation of the hotel’s own property attributes, but it is worthwhile exploring the hotel’s courtyard and gardens, peerless rooftop views of the city and the outstanding food proffered by its restaurants, including the Michelin-starred Imago and the Salone Eva, and Bar service reportedly highly favored by the likes of Princess Diana. When in Rome, might as well splurge on yourself like the Romans do with a stay at the Hassler. Just pulling up at the elegant front entrance to check in is a trip all by itself.
